Do Macros cause corruption of big files
 
I frequently use Macros for formatting csv, dat or prn type of files. I am
told that such frequent use of Macros may corrupt the files. Is it true?

Dave Peterson

Do Macros cause corruption of big files
 
Since .csv and .prn (and .dat???) are plain old text files, they shouldn't be
corruptible at all.

If you're saving the file as .xls, then I've never noticed any correlation
between macro use and corrupt files. But I'd say finding the reason a file gets
corrupted is pretty difficult.
